Output 8ea8e4e18762d4a2e1c372ea6acaf0801b1e091f3858bb82276858c8733629f9:2

value
11019633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1c589ffe1f4029d9a722fac4914765e1ea9622c OP_EQUAL
address
3NGnbxeDeYTjYC6tsPkXuJ7MpLhts1Ghpy
transaction
8ea8e4e18762d4a2e1c372ea6acaf0801b1e091f3858bb82276858c8733629f9
confirmations
325251
spent
true